Arne Slot calls for more work to deal with racism in football

Liverpool manager Arne Slot has called for more work to be put to avaoid racism in football following recent allegations by Real Madrid winger Vinicius Jr.

The Tuesday incident saw the Brazilian winger accuse the Benfica winger Gianluca Prestianni of racially abusing him during their 1-0 win in the Champions League play offs.

Both the Benfica winger, the club and manager Jose Mourinho denied the allegations even though UEFA confirmed that they were investigating the issue.

“In general you can never do enough, you can always do more to make sure this (racism in football) never happens again,” said Slot

“We have to try as a football community to do more than society does. That’s maybe not so difficult, by the way. Protocol was followed in the game, that’s the first step,” he continued
